Primary phylogenomic analysis optimized against systematic error; support for Arachnida and Acari is dataset- and model-conditioned.
Claim ledger
topology · contestedGenomic-scale chelicerate analyses using different taxon sets, slowly evolving genes, heterogeneous models and total evidence recover mutually incompatible monophyletic or paraphyletic Arachnida; one versus multiple terrestrializations and Cambrian–Ordovician timing are model-dependent historical reconstructions.
